Head Start shakeup stirs protest at Pine Ridge
Thursday, November 13, 2003

Members of the Oglala Sioux Tribe of South Dakota are demanding the firing of four federal Head Start program employees.

This summer, the Head Start program terminated 150 people for not meeting various federal government requirements. According to President John Yellow Bird Steele, the Department of Education threatened to cut off federal funds for the program.

But the tribal members say the way the program is being managed by the federal employees isn't working. They want local people to run the Head Start.
